Saim Ayub has etched his name in the annals of cricket history by becoming the first player to score a century and a double-century in a Quaid-e-Azam Trophy final.

The remarkable feat occurred during the 2023/24 Quaid-e-Azam Trophy final at Lahore’s Gaddafi Stadium.

Opening the batting for the Karachi Region Whites, Ayub demonstrated his formidable skills with the bat, scoring an impressive 203 runs in 259 balls during the first innings. The Faisalabad Region had won the toss and opted to bowl, but they were met with an indomitable partnership between Ayub and Shan Masood, who contributed a solid 180 runs. Their partnership amassed a staggering 379 runs, guiding Karachi Whites to a total of 543.

The Faisalabad Region struggled in response, with Mir Hamza (5-44) and Shahnawaz Dahani (4-50) delivering exceptional bowling performances, which resulted in their team being bowled out for a mere 124 runs.

Despite enjoying a commanding 419-run lead, Karachi Whites’ captain, Sarfaraz Ahmed, made the bold decision to bat once more, likely influenced by the substantial time remaining in the match. In this second innings, Ayub continued his fine form by scoring 109 runs, making him the first player to achieve a double century and a century in a Quaid-e-Azam Trophy final.

This extraordinary accomplishment places Saim Ayub in an elite list of Pakistani cricketers who have scored a double hundred and another century in the same first-class match. Some of the notable cricketers on this list include legends such as Zaheer Abbas and Younis Khan.

While Karachi Whites were 238-5 at the end of day three in this five-day showdown, they have accumulated a commanding lead of 657 runs, positioning themselves as favorites to clinch the Quaid-e-Azam Trophy.

This historic achievement by Saim Ayub will undoubtedly be remembered as one of the most exceptional performances in Pakistan’s domestic cricket, and it cements his status as one of the rising stars in the country’s cricketing landscape.
